Type
ORACLE
Validation date
2024-11-01 08: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01492,
    "usd": 0.01622
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A2A9194830F94E4A0ADE01D028112E6962FDD106416A304AD70A3419B32FEAF2

Previous signature

B42A2278C31E8C10F14FE6A42FF010D74415DBD748580B8A81CAFEBB824E96DDA3F26FCD12A063CDC469057CF197520AD0B850A9144A2D0D7240FC9A57C72500

Origin signature

304502204DB3DD7A4E3568ABC6341C71C25572F84F1F7A9B50145C45438E5E4DDA5A01E0022100A39ABF0587B886CEEBAAF4426B32D109ABBAE1A8FEB9E064FC1D8D3DD80EF52D

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

001CAB1BE85F520D777D2882BEFB8F299B0252F0CF6134E113059340122CF0CAFE

Coordinator signature

050E4BD973902D22B3851FF172CEC8A414E2BBCFEAE3972265199DE7459ED905AD7D8B50A9F2964AF3B4A3FDAC1B54350BD210FA1498E19E3381535893CA260B

Validator #1 public key

00016DC3C25720E8FB335A38DB1D57FA1CD8AD5287C212B53343907DFA124394C684

Validator #1 signature

AC92E2383B4EFCB1D010901CA2C6A1BD9208D7267602A2EF6FDE64DF7DAE708BA7785523F5514C994239CAA5E74B9F812CAB896F867E1EF2C7FE029C71C4E90C

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

5207D52659B1AF7E093223C8FCECBB8EA04C6D39143BAFB72DA938A812367F2CE10A65F0924FFB35FAD9E79861D754D931A82984982A3A185428CA0D52D27D07